An additional grant of patent rights can be found in the PATENTS file in the same directory. ]]-- local tnt = require 'torchnet.env' local argcheck = require 'argcheck' local doc = require 'argcheck.doc' doc[[ ### tnt.SGDEngine The `SGDEngine` module implements the Stochastic Gradient Descent training procedure in `train`, including data sampling, forward prop, back prop, and parameter updates. It also operates as a coroutine allowing a user control (i.e. increment some sort of `tnt.Meter`) at events such as 'start', 'start-epoch', 'forward', 'forward-criterion', 'backward', etc. The available hooks are the following: ```lua hooks = { ['onStart'] = function() end, -- Right before training ['onStartEpoch'] = function() end, -- Before new epoch ['onSample'] = function() end, -- After getting a sample ['onForward'] = function() end, -- After model:forward ['onForwardCriterion'] = function() end, -- After criterion:forward ['onBackwardCriterion'] = function() end, -- After criterion:backward ['onBackward'] = function() end, -- After model:backward ['onUpdate'] = function() end, -- After UpdateParameters ['onEndEpoch'] = function() end, -- Right before completing epoch ['onEnd'] = function() end, -- After training } ``` To specify a new closure for a given hook, we can access to it with `engine.hooks.`. For example, we could reset a `Meter` before every epoch by: ```lua local engine = tnt.SGDEngine() local meter = tnt.AverageValueMeter() engine.hooks.onStartEpoch = function(state) meter:reset() end ``` Accordingly, `train` requires a network (`nn.Module`), a criterion expressing the loss function (`nn.Criterion`), a dataset iterator (`tnt.DatasetIterator`), and a learning rate, at the minimum. The `test` function allows for simple evaluation of a model on a dataset. A `state` is maintained for external access to outputs and parameters of modules as well as sampled data. The content of the `state` table is the following, where the passed values come from the arguments of `engine:train()`: ```lua state = { ['network'] = network, ['criterion'] = criterion, ['iterator'] = iterator, ['lr'] = lr, ['lrcriterion'] = lrcriterion, ['maxepoch'] = maxepoch, ['sample'] = {}, ['epoch'] = 0, -- epoch done so far ['t'] = 0, -- samples seen so far ['training'] = true } ``` ]] require 'nn' local SGDEngine, Engine = torch.class('tnt.SGDEngine', 'tnt.Engine', tnt) SGDEngine.__init = argcheck{ {name="self", type="tnt.SGDEngine"}, call = function(self) Engine.__init(self, { "onStart", "onStartEpoch", "onSample", "onForward", "onForwardCriterion", "onBackward", "onBackwardCriterion", "onEndEpoch", "onUpdate", "onEnd" }) end } SGDEngine.train = argcheck{ {name="self", type="tnt.SGDEngine"}, {name="network", type="nn.Module"}, {name="criterion", type="nn.Criterion"}, {name="iterator", type="tnt.DatasetIterator"}, {name="lr", type="number"}, {name="lrcriterion", type="number", defaulta="lr"}, {name="maxepoch", type="number", default=1000}, call = function(self, network, criterion, iterator, lr, lrcriterion, maxepoch) local state = { network = network, criterion = criterion, iterator = iterator, lr = lr, lrcriterion = lrcriterion, maxepoch = maxepoch, sample = {}, epoch = 0, -- epoch done so far t = 0, -- samples seen so far training = true } self.hooks("onStart", state) while state.epoch < state.maxepoch do state.network:training() self.hooks("onStartEpoch", state) for sample in state.iterator() do state.sample = sample self.hooks("onSample", state) state.network:forward(sample.input) self.hooks("onForward", state) state.criterion:forward(state.network.output, sample.target) self.hooks("onForwardCriterion", state) state.network:zeroGradParameters() if state.criterion.zeroGradParameters then state.criterion:zeroGradParameters() end state.criterion:backward(state.network.output, sample.target) self.hooks("onBackwardCriterion", state) state.network:backward(sample.input, state.criterion.gradInput) self.hooks("onBackward", state) assert(state.lrcriterion >= 0, 'lrcriterion should be positive or zero') if state.lrcriterion > 0 and state.criterion.updateParameters then state.criterion:updateParameters(state.lrcriterion) end assert(state.lr >= 0, 'lr should be positive or zero') if state.lr > 0 then state.network:updateParameters(state.lr) end state.t = state.t + 1 self.hooks("onUpdate", state) end state.epoch = state.epoch + 1 self.hooks("onEndEpoch", state) end self.hooks("onEnd", state) end } SGDEngine.test = argcheck{ {name="self", type="tnt.SGDEngine"}, {name="network", type="nn.Module"}, {name="iterator", type="tnt.DatasetIterator"}, {name="criterion", type="nn.Criterion", opt=true}, call = function(self, network, iterator, criterion) local state = { network = network, iterator = iterator, criterion = criterion, sample = {}, t = 0, -- samples seen so far training = false } self.hooks("onStart", state) state.network:evaluate() for sample in state.iterator() do state.sample = sample self.hooks("onSample", state) state.network:forward(sample.input) state.t = state.t + 1 self.hooks("onForward", state) if state.criterion then state.criterion:forward(state.network.output, sample.target) self.hooks("onForwardCriterion", state) end end self.hooks("onEnd", state) end }
